Literally nothing in the article points to it being eliminated, only reaching a target of diagnosing 90% of the cases, which doesn't do anything to eliminate it when a large number of cases comes from drug users which are unlikely to care very much about it.
vlovich123•2m ago
> The target of treating 80% of all known cases has already been met, and deaths from the virus have fallen by 36% in the last decade, just short of what is needed by 2030. Taking antiviral tablets for 8 to 12 weeks can cure more than 95% of cases.

So indeed diagnosing the cases is leading directly to deaths prevented.
